Seattle Police say two people were listed in stable condition after they were shot in what witnesses called a gun battle in the Central District Tuesday night.

The shooting happened around 8:56 p.m. near the intersection of East Alder Street and Martin Luther King Jr. Way and involved four people according to a witness who told police they were all shooting at each other.

Officers arriving at the scene found two injured people, and medics took a 24-year-old woman and a 27-year-old man to Harborview Medical Center with gunshot wounds.

Police say multiple homes were damaged by the gunfire and recovered about 24 shell casings.

No arrests were made.
